Output ad7097ed91b8092f771602fb7b2f76f9f45241e1a30e748eacbbd8ce118eb94b:1

value
40344909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c7649e0cc2ad79bb5afaaef13704f264cce4ca OP_EQUAL
address
33x31De8759PyjJpYAthPVUon1ySe6fVzF
transaction
ad7097ed91b8092f771602fb7b2f76f9f45241e1a30e748eacbbd8ce118eb94b
spent
true